Output d70a485dfc561890c7ef0d6ed5c3a874a6259d0e205a27a315f8d9079b492315:2

value
24881361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ac5d2d610c32a79fbe643c83b36b9f72c8d8520a OP_EQUAL
address
MPcY5VeP8itRBxmrPCJCqoKdhbvsp7UsLb
transaction
d70a485dfc561890c7ef0d6ed5c3a874a6259d0e205a27a315f8d9079b492315
spent
true